In this review of the FROGG TOGGS Rana II PVC Bootfoot Chest Wader, the bottom line is simple: anglers and hunters who need a lightweight, waterproof wader for general wading and shore fishing will appreciate the Rana II for its dependable watertight protection and modest price. The Rana II is best for seasonal or occasional use where a non-insulated, durable nylon-reinforced PVC upper and taped seams are more important than thermal insulation. This review focuses on fit, construction, and real-world use so you can decide if its features match your needs.
Key Features
- Nylon-reinforced PVC upper: Provides abrasion resistance and a structured fit that holds up to repeated entry and exit from water.
- 100% taped seams: Watertight taped seams offer reliable waterproofing so anglers can wade without worrying about seam leaks.
- Adjustable H-back suspenders: Web suspenders with quick release buckles make it easy to adjust and remove the waders quickly when needed.
- Flip-out chest pocket and top draw cord: A flip-out security pocket plus draw cord keep small essentials close and secure while on the water.
- 2mm PVC boot: Integrated non-insulated boot in either felt or cleated styles protects feet and eliminates the need for separate wading boots.
- Lightweight construction: The overall weight and materials make the Rana II comfortable for long periods of standing and light walking in water.
Who It's For
The Rana II is aimed at recreational anglers, surf and shore fishers, and hunters who need a budget-friendly, waterproof chest wader that performs in wet conditions without adding insulated bulk. It is a good match for spring through fall outings or mild-weather fishing where keeping dry is the priority rather than warmth.
Those who should look elsewhere include anglers who require heavy insulation for cold-weather wading, people who need a precision fit for technical river wading, or users seeking premium hardware and lifetime puncture resistance; some customers have reported fit variations and occasional hardware failures under heavy use.
Pros & Cons
Pros
- Durable nylon-reinforced PVC upper offers solid abrasion resistance for routine use.
- 100% taped seams deliver dependable waterproofing for wading and surf work.
- Quick-release H-back suspenders and a flip-out pocket add useful convenience on the water.
- Lightweight feel makes prolonged wear more comfortable than heavier waders.
Cons
- Non-insulated 2mm PVC boots are not suitable for cold-weather wading or extended immersion in cold water.
- Fit and some hardware (plastic buckles) have mixed feedback from users and may not suit everyone.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these waders fully waterproof?
Yes, the Rana II uses nylon-reinforced PVC with 100% taped seams for watertight protection.
Do the boots provide insulation for cold water?
No, the integrated boots are 2mm non-insulated PVC and are intended for protection, not thermal insulation.
Can I choose the boot outsole type?
Yes, the Rana II boots are available with either a felt or cleated outsole depending on preferred traction.
